Atelier T8.A03

TITRE :

Comment Programmer les GPU (openMP, openACC, Cuda, openCL, par toolbox ou librairie).

PORTEURS

Arnaud Renard et Jean-Matthieu Etancelin Centre de calcul ROMEO et Francois Courteille/Nvidia.

MOTS CLES

GPU, OpenMP, openACC, Cuda, openCL, librairie, simulations parallèles, parallèlisme, calcul intensif, HPC, GPU.

OBJECTIF :

  • Le but est de faire un tour d’horizon des enjeux et des techniques pour utiliser des GPU de manière efficace.

DESCRIPTION :

  • Savoir utiliser des standards comme OpenACC, ou OpenMP des langages comme CUDA, openCL oud es librairies afin de porter ou developper son code sur des architectures comportant des cartes graphiques.

PREREQUIS :

La connaissance d’un langage de programmation (Fortran, C, …) est souhaitable. Avoir suivi l'atelier T8.AP02 est un plus.

 
jdev2017/t8.a03.txt · Dernière modification: 2017/04/28 16:14 par etienne.gondet@get.obs-mip.fr
 
Recent changes RSS feed Powered by PHP Powered by Pxxo Driven by DokuWiki